Analysis

Afghanistan recorded 3.6% for prevalence of wasting, weight for height in 2022. That is the lowest value across all 5 years on record.

That represents a change of down 62.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, prevalence of wasting, weight for height in Afghanistan peaked at 17.3% in 1997 and was at its lowest, 3.6%, in 2022.

Afghanistan ranks 54th of 99 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Prevalence of wasting, weight for height in Afghanistan, year by year

Annual values for Prevalence of wasting, weight for height (% of children under 5) in Afghanistan, 1997 to 2022.
Year % of children under 5 Change
1997 17.3%
2004 9.1% -47.4%
2013 9.5% +4.4%
2018 5.1% -46.3%
2022 3.6% -29.4%

Prevalence of wasting is the proportion of children under age 5 whose weight for height is more than two standard deviations below the median for the international reference population ages 0-59 months.
